Seyfettin
Seyfettin is a Turkish name of Arabic origin. It is a combination of the words "seyyf" meaning "sword" and "deen" meaning "religion" or "faith". Therefore, the name Seyfettin can be interpreted to mean "sword of faith" or "sword of religion". In Islamic culture, the sword symbolizes strength, bravery, and protection, while faith is a core aspect of one's beliefs and values.
In Turkish society, names are carefully chosen to reflect the characteristics parents hope their child will embody. As such, the name Seyfettin may be given to a child with the aspiration that they will grow up to be strong, courageous, and devoted to their beliefs. The combination of the powerful imagery of a sword and the steadfastness of faith makes Seyfettin a significant and meaningful name in Turkish culture.
